Subject: [Xenomai-help] Install xenomai with vxWorks Skin on Ubuntu 11.04
Date: Fri, 08 Jul 2011 17:30:51 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<4E1722AB.3030900@domain.hid> (raw)

i am new to Xenomai so please forgive me if my question is silly

i have installed xenomai 2.4.8 in my ubuntu 11.04 with the command

     apt-get install libxenomai-dev

Now i want test a simple vxWorks program, but when i compile my program, 
i receive this message

     Xenomai: vxworks skin or CONFIG_XENO_OPT_PERVASIVE disabled
     (modprobe xeno_vxworks?)

and output of modprobe xeno_vxworks is

     FATAL: Module xeno_vxworks not found

My question is, how can i eanble xeno_vxworks module ?
